Chicken Parm Mini Meatloaf Muffins Recipe

  • Total Time: 37 minutes
  • Yield: 12 mini meatloaves 1x

These Chicken Parm Mini Meatloaf Muffins are a delightful twist on a classic favorite. Perfectly portioned and bursting with flavor, these mini meatloaves are sure to be a hit with the whole family. Juicy ground chicken mixed with bre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, and Italian seasonings, topped with marinara sauce and gooey mozzarella, these mini meatloaves are baked to perfection in a muffin tin.


Ingredients

Scale

For the Mini Meatloaves:

  • 1 pound ground chicken
  • 1/2 cup breadcrumbs
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
  • 1 large egg
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per

For Assembly and Baking:

  • 1 cup marinara sauce
  • 3/4 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• Nonstick cooking spray

Instructions

  1. Preheat and Prepare: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and lightly grease a 12-cup muffin tin with nonstick spray.
  2. Mix the Meatloaf: In a large mixing bowl, combine ground chicken, bre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, parsley, egg, garlic,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per. Mix until just combined—do not overmix.
  3. Fill the Muffin Cups: Evenly divide the mixture among the muffin cups, pressing gently to fill each well. Use the back of a spoon to slightly indent the tops.
  4. Add Sauce and Bake: Spoon a tablespoon of marinara sauce over each mini meatloaf, then bake for 20 minutes.
  5. Top with Cheese: Remove from the oven, top each with shredded mozzarella, and return to the oven for another 5–7 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and the meatloaves reach 165°F internally.
  6. Serve: Let cool slightly before removing from the tin. Serve with spaghetti, roasted veggies, or on a slider bun for a fun twist.

Notes

  • Serve with spaghetti, roasted veggies, or on a slider bun for a fun twist.
  • These mini meatloaves freeze well and are great for meal prep!
